From Taylor:

"Blending a responsive feel with a, warm, seasoned sound, the Gold Label 712e adds an alluring new flavor of tone to our collection of heritage-inspired acoustic guitars. This compact Grand Concert features slightly increased body depth in a frame that remains accommodating for players of all statures, combining Indian rosewood back and sides with a torrefied Sitka spruce top for a dynamic, versatile voice that responds to an array of playing styles. Fingerstyle players will appreciate the top-end clarity and sparkle of that tonewood pairing, while flatpickers and strummers will love its rich low-end presence and blooming harmonic character. The fanned V-Class bracing inside provides a boost to volume, sustain and resonance across the frequency spectrum, while the slender Action Control Neck and its long-tenon joint enhance both warmth and microadjustability. Other details for this model reflect its throwback character, including cream-colored binding with a matching rosette trimmed in black, Crest inlays, a Honduran rosewood Curve Wing bridge, and a natural glossy finish. It includes LR Baggs Element VTC electronics and ships in a deluxe British Cocoa hardshell case."

Brand New, Grand Concert Body Shape, Sitka Spruce Top with Indian Rosewood Back and Sides, Gloss Finish, Fanned V-Class Bracing with Tonal Rout, Cream/Black Rosette, 2-Piece Back Configuration (No Wedge), Cream Body Binding, Neo-Tropical Mahogany Neck with Satin Finish and Standard Carve, West African Crelicam Ebony Fingerboard with Cream Crest Inlays and Ebony Binding, 24-7/8″ Scale Length, 1 3/4″ Nut Width, White TUSQ Nut and White Micarta Saddle, Honduran Rosewood Bridge with Matching Bridge Pins, Taylor Nickel Tuners with Nickel Buttons, LR Baggs Element VTC Pickup System, Firestripe Pickguard, Includes Taylor Deluxe British Cocoa Hardshell Case.
